Common Mold Remediation Scams in Dawson Springs
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Fake Mold Detection
Scammer does a quick walkthrough, declares widespread 'toxic mold,' pushes expensive full-home remediation.
Deposit and Dash
Takes 50%+ deposit, starts superficial work, then vanishes or demands more money.
Ineffective Treatments
Applies bleach or paints over mold, claiming it's fixed—mold returns quickly.
Bait-and-Switch Pricing
Low initial quote balloons after 'surprise' findings with no documentation.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a Certificate of Insurance for $1M+ general liability and workers' comp. Call the insurer to confirm it's active.
Licensing
Kentucky has no specific mold remediation license, but verify general contractor registration on the Department of Housing, Buildings and Construction (DHBC) website. Ask for certifications like IICRC CMRT or RIA.
References
Get 3+ recent Hopkins County references. Call to verify work quality, completeness, and if mold returned.
